Esmi — Virtual Receptionist
24/7 call handling that books appointments, routes urgent calls, and works in English and Spanish — an AI receptionist, not a person. Every call ends with a full transcript and a reason.

- Availability
- Nights, weekends, and holidays — the line is never unattended
- Languages
- English and Spanish natively; French as an add-on; switches mid-call
- Booking
- Google Calendar live book/reschedule, confirmed with an SMS reminder
- Routing
- After-hours emergencies go to the on-call person instead of a voicemail box
- Record
- Every call ends with a transcript, a reason, and a disposition
- Tuning
- Coachable by editing a document — no engineer required
On the same console — in development
Revenue-Ops Agents
Qualify every lead, follow up on time, and keep the pipeline moving while your team runs the conversations that matter.
- Intake
- Web forms, inbound calls, paid social, and referral links in one pipeline
- Scoring
- A defensible score built from fit, intent signals, and account history
- Follow-up
- Email, SMS, and call cadences written in your voice, not a template
- Hand-off
- Your reps inherit a brief with talking points, not a blank record
- CRM
- Hand-off into the CRM you already use — wiring scoped per engagement (roadmap, not a native connector catalog)
- Reporting
- A Monday scorecard: what moved, what stalled, and why
Revenue-Ops is in development. The capabilities above describe what it is being built to do, not what is running in your account today. If a pilot depends on it, say so and we will tell you honestly where it stands.
